Benefits of Accounting Tools for Small Businesses

Accounting tools for small businesses are software platforms designed to automate financial tasks like bookkeeping, invoicing, expense tracking, and reporting. They enable business owners to manage their finances efficiently while reducing errors and saving time. These cloud-based solutions have become essential for entrepreneurs who need real-time visibility into their cash flow without hiring a full accounting department.

How Accounting Tools Transform Small Business Operations

Modern accounting software goes far beyond basic number-crunching—it fundamentally changes how small businesses operate. By centralizing financial data into one comprehensive platform, these tools eliminate the scattered spreadsheets and filing cabinets that plague traditional bookkeeping methods. Business owners gain instant access to critical financial information that would previously require hours of manual compilation.

The automation capabilities are particularly transformative. Instead of spending evenings reconciling bank statements or chasing down receipts, entrepreneurs can focus on revenue-generating activities while their accounting software handles repetitive tasks in the background. This shift from reactive bookkeeping to proactive financial management represents a fundamental advantage for resource-constrained small businesses.

Small business accounting software streamlines daily financial tasks

With the right tools, daily financial management becomes dramatically simpler. Automated bank feeds pull transactions directly into your accounting system, while intelligent categorization learns your spending patterns and assigns expenses to the correct accounts. Invoice generation transforms from a tedious process into a few clicks, with professional templates that you can customize to match your brand.

Payment tracking happens automatically—the software monitors which invoices are paid, which are overdue, and sends automated reminders to clients without any manual intervention. This alone can accelerate cash flow significantly, addressing the late payment crisis affecting 56% of US small businesses, who are owed an average of $17,500 in outstanding payments. Expense tracking becomes as simple as photographing a receipt with your phone, with optical character recognition technology extracting the relevant details and filing them appropriately.

Accounting solutions for small enterprises eliminate costly errors

Human error in financial recordkeeping can be devastating for small businesses. Automated data entry systems achieve 99.96% to 99.99% accuracy, compared to human data entry which ranges from 96% to 99%. When processing 10,000 entries, automated systems make only 1 to 4 errors while humans make between 100 and 400 errors. The software enforces data validation rules that catch mistakes before they become problems.

Built-in error checking flags unusual transactions, duplicate entries, or inconsistencies that warrant attention. This level of accuracy is particularly crucial during tax season when the IRS scrutinizes small business returns, reducing audit risk substantially.

How COGS Work with Inventory

Cost of Goods Sold (COGS) refers to expenses related directly to producing or purchasing inventory items for sale or resale. Inventory is a line item on the balance sheet and is considered an asset that the company holds. Inventory is one of the most critical assets for companies in the distribution industry. When inventory sells, the revenue appears in the income statement. The cost of procuring that item is known as COGS. Manufacturers also use COGS for the purchase of raw materials.  

Periodic inventory ADP. Payroll – HR – Benefits  

Under the periodic system, the amount in the inventory account doesn’t update when a company is purchasing inventory; it updates after a specified amount of time, usually annually. The inventory amount is only updated after a fiscal year finishes and the new year starts; this means that the inventory account won’t show you the cost of the stock for last year. All the purchases related to merchandise are entered and recorded in either one or more than one purchase account. When the year is about to end, the purchase accounts are closed by the company. By following the periodic system, there is no cost of goods sold when recording the sale of merchandise. 

Assumptions for cost flow 

IRS accepts three methods to move the cost to the income statement from the balance sheet. The three methods used are FIFO, LIFO, and Average Cost. They display what their names suggest and direct the order in which items flow from the inventory and money is moved on the balance sheet. FIFO means first in, first out, meaning that goods should come out of stock in the order received and their costs shown at their original purchase price. LIFO means last in, first out, removing the most recently received item first and recording inventory at its original purchase price. Perpetual form of inventory system 

While following a perpetual system, the stock account is being updated at regular intervals by the company. Inventory adjusts when the actual cost of products purchased from the suppliers occurs; on the other side, the accounts adjust immediately as the items sell to customers. There is no chance for purchase accounts in this perpetual system of inventory. The actual price of sold products has a history, and that account adjusts at the time each sale occurs, which is the same for the cost related to the merchandise. Sales and accounts receivable both change to the record as one entry. On the other hand, the different products added to the inventory list decrease, and they start to make maximum the price of products sold to the customers. 

FIFO (first-in, first-out), LIFO (last-in, first-out), and Average cash flow assumptions are merged with any inventory systems, either perpetual inventory systems or periodic inventory systems, to determine the actual cost of the stock at hand. Indication of a perpetual system 

The perpetual system clearly shows and ensures that a company’s inventory account will always show accurate figures as accounts update in real-time at regular time intervals. In other words, you can say that the balance in the Inventory account will start to increase by the amount of the goods purchased. This amount decreases by the cost of the goods when a sale occurs. So, it illustrates that the balance in the Inventory account should tell you more about the cost of the inventory items that are on your hand right now. Also, the companies should count the actual number and cost of their goods that they are having at the current time (take a physical inventory) at least once a year. They should adjust the perpetual records if necessary for the company.

Understanding Common Accounting Errors: What Every Business Owner Needs to Know

Financial accuracy forms the backbone of successful business operations, yet accounting errors continue to undermine companies across all industries. These mistakes range from simple data entry errors to complex misclassifications that distort financial reality for months before discovery.

The most damaging aspect of accounting errors lies not in their individual impact but in their cumulative effect. A misplaced decimal point might seem trivial until it triggers a cascade of incorrect financial decisions. Understanding these error types provides the foundation for building robust prevention systems.

Major types of accounting errors

Data Entry Errors represent the most frequent category, occurring when manual input creates typing mistakes, transposed numbers, or misplaced decimal points. A $1,000 payment recorded as $10,000 instantly distorts cash flow projections and financial ratios.

Misclassification Errors involve recording transactions in incorrect accounts or categories. Common examples include:

  • Recording operating expenses as capital expenditures
  • Mixing personal and business transactions
  • Categorizing revenue in the wrong period
  • Confusing assets with liabilities

Omission Errors occur when transactions disappear entirely from the books. These gaps often emerge from:

  • Lost invoices or receipts
  • Forgotten bank transactions
  • Unrecorded cash payments
  • Missing credit card charges

Calculation Errors arise from incorrect formulas, math mistakes, or misapplied accounting principles when computing depreciation, interest, or tax obligations.

Duplicate Entries happen when the same transaction gets recorded multiple times, inflating both revenues and expenses while creating reconciliation nightmares.

Reconciliation Failures represent the breakdown of verification processes, leaving discrepancies between bank statements, vendor accounts, and internal records undetected for extended periods.

Most Costly Accounting Pitfalls and How to Spot Them Early

Early detection of bookkeeping mistakes prevents minor errors from evolving into major financial disasters. Smart business owners implement warning systems that flag potential problems before they compound.

Watch for these red flags indicating potential accounting errors:

  • Unusual account balances that deviate significantly from historical patterns
  • Missing invoices or gaps in sequential numbering systems
  • Bank reconciliations that never quite balance
  • Vendor complaints about payment discrepancies
  • Tax notices indicating mismatched reported amounts

Regular variance analysis serves as your financial early warning system. By comparing actual results against budgets and prior periods, unexpected discrepancies become visible immediately. Cloud-based accounting systems enhance this capability through real-time dashboards and automated alerts for unusual transactions.

Maintaining clear audit trails transforms error detection from guesswork into systematic investigation. Modern accounting software tracks every change, showing who made modifications and when, making error correction straightforward rather than archaeological.

Real-World Case Study: From Bookkeeping Disaster to Financial Success

A fast-growing software startup discovered their cash position differed from accounting records by $75,000—a potentially fatal discrepancy for a company their size. Investigation revealed multiple issues: duplicate vendor payments, misclassified customer deposits, and data entry errors compounding over six months.

The root cause traced back to rapid growth overwhelming their manual accounting processes. As transaction volume tripled, their part-time bookkeeper struggled to maintain accuracy while juggling multiple responsibilities. Error rates climbed from occasional mistakes to systematic failures.

Implementation of cloud-based accounting software with bank feed integration eliminated manual data entry for 90% of transactions. Segregation of duties meant invoice approval, payment processing, and reconciliation became separate functions performed by different team members. Monthly reconciliation schedules replaced sporadic reviews.

Results exceeded expectations:

  • Accuracy improved to 99.9% within three months
  • Month-end close time decreased from two weeks to three days
  • The company avoided $25,000 in potential tax penalties
  • Management regained confidence in financial reports for strategic decisions

Key takeaways from this transformation apply to businesses at any stage. Automated data entry eliminates the majority of human error opportunities. Regular review cycles catch remaining mistakes before they compound. Cross-functional verification creates natural quality control checkpoints throughout the accounting process. Best Practices for Error-Free Bookkeeping

Building bulletproof accounting processes requires combining technology, procedures, and human oversight into an integrated system. These proven practices eliminate the vast majority of common accounting errors while creating sustainable financial management.

Leverage Modern Accounting Software by selecting platforms with built-in error prevention:

  • Automated bank feeds eliminate manual transaction entry
  • Validation rules flag unusual amounts or account combinations
  • Real-time reporting surfaces discrepancies immediately
  • Audit trails track all changes for easy error correction

Implement Segregation of Duties to create natural verification points:

  • Invoice approval is separate from payment processing
  • Transaction recording is independent of reconciliation
  • Different team members handle receipts versus disbursements
  • Regular rotation prevents any individual from controlling entire processes

Establish Documentation Standards through consistent procedures:

  • Digital receipt capture at point of transaction
  • Clear naming conventions for all files
  • Centralized cloud storage accessible to authorized users
  • Regular backups protecting against data loss

Schedule Monthly Reconciliations as non-negotiable activities:

  • Bank statement matching within five days of month-end
  • Credit card reconciliation before payment due dates
  • Vendor statement reviews catching billing discrepancies
  • Inter-company account verification for multi-entity businesses

Invest in Continuous Training to maintain team competency:

  • Software update education as features evolve
  • Accounting principle refreshers for complex transactions
  • Error pattern analysis sharing lessons learned
  • Cross-training ensuring coverage during absences

From Mistakes to Mastery: Your Accounting Transformation Roadmap

Transforming error-prone accounting into reliable financial management follows a predictable path. Success requires commitment to systematic improvement rather than hoping for overnight miracles.

Phase 1: Assessment and Prioritization

Identify your current error patterns by reviewing recent mistakes. Categorize them by frequency and impact to focus initial efforts on high-value improvements. Small businesses often discover that 80% of errors stem from 20% of processes.

Phase 2: Technology Implementation

Select and deploy accounting software matching your business complexity. Start with core functions like bank feeds and basic reporting before adding advanced features. Allow adequate time for data migration and testing.

Phase 3: Process Standardization

Document standard operating procedures for all routine accounting tasks. Create checklists ensuring consistency regardless of who performs the work. Build review points into workflows rather than treating verification as optional.

Phase 4: Training and Adoption

Invest time teaching team members both software mechanics and underlying accounting concepts. Understanding why procedures exist improves compliance more than memorizing steps. Regular refreshers maintain standards as teams evolve.

Phase 5: Continuous Improvement

Monitor error rates monthly, investigating root causes for any increases. Adjust processes based on real-world results rather than theoretical perfection. Celebrate accuracy improvements to reinforce positive behaviors.

Frequently Asked Questions About Common Accounting Errors

What are the most common bookkeeping mistakes small businesses make?

The most frequent errors include data entry mistakes like transposed numbers or misplaced decimals, misclassifying transactions between expense categories, forgetting to record cash transactions, failing to reconcile accounts monthly, and mixing personal with business expenses.

How can accounting automation help prevent errors?

Automation prevents errors by eliminating manual data entry through bank feeds, flagging duplicate transactions automatically, applying consistent categorization rules, generating real-time alerts for unusual activity, and maintaining complete audit trails for every change.

What are the consequences of accounting errors for small businesses?

Consequences include IRS penalties and interest on misreported taxes, damaged relationships with investors and lenders who lose trust, poor business decisions based on incorrect financial data, operational disruptions from cash flow surprises, and significant stress on owners and staff.

How often should I reconcile my accounting records?

Best practice requires monthly reconciliation for all accounts, including bank accounts, credit cards, and vendor statements. High-transaction businesses benefit from weekly or even daily reconciliations to catch errors quickly before they compound.

What are effective strategies to avoid tax preparation missteps?

Effective strategies include maintaining organized digital documentation throughout the year, implementing accounting software with tax tracking features, scheduling quarterly reviews with tax professionals, training staff on deductibility rules, and conducting year-end preparation reviews before filing.
